Be a part of a growing company with a stable market. NCH is an 89-year old, multi-national manufacturer of industrial maintenance products. World headquarters is located in Irving, Texas.
NCH manufactures and markets an extensive line of maintenance, repair and supply products to customers in over 55 countries worldwide. NCH products include chemical specialties, fasteners, welding alloys and plumbing parts as well as maintenance and supply products. These products are sold and serviced primarily through the Corporation’s own sales force.
Summary:
We are currently seeking a Local/Regional Delivery Driver to manage local and regional deliveries and pump-offs. This position is a casual/part-time position, averaging about 20 hours of work each week. (Some weeks could offer fewer hours, some weeks could offer additional hours.) This position is based out of our Macon, GA facility, and will operate in the South-East region of the US; some overnight stays required.
Responsibilities for this position include, but are not limited to:
• Drive various company vehicles around the greater metro and outlying areas
• Ensure safe and efficient delivery of company products and services
• Operate various material handling equipment, chemical transfer pumps and other equipment that may be required
• Maintain driver logs, trip expense reports along with pre/post trip reports
• Alternate local/regional routes
Requirements and Qualifications for this position include:
• Safety-conscious in driving and work
• High School degree, or equivalent
• 2-3 years experience driving with a valid CDL
• Current CDL driver’s license with HAZ-MAT endorsements
• Ability to learn and use proper personal protection equipment
• Ability to pass the DOT certification drug screens and physical exams
• Ability to move drums, perform chemical pump transfers and operate various equipment (often weighing 75 – 100 lbs) on and off truck
• Daily interaction with customers, MUST have a customer friendly focus
